The four sides of a square plate of side 12 cm, made of homogeneous material, are kept at constant temperature and as shown in Fig. Using a (very wide) grid of mesh 4 cm and applying Gauss-Seidel iteration with ek < 0.0001, find the (steady-state) temperature at the mesh (interior) points. y u = 0 12 u = 100 u = 100 R 12 u = 100
